    Delaware Code
    Chapter 50. INSURANCE HOLDING COMPANY SYSTEM REGISTRATION
    § 5008. Rules and regulations.

    The Commissioner may, upon notice and opportunity for all interested persons to be heard, issue such rules, regulations and orders as shall be necessary to carry out the provisions of this chapter.
